The map would best be used in a report titled The Great Lakes. The lakes are considered a very important part of the North American cultural heritage.

<h3>What are the names of the five great lakes?</h3>

From the west to the east, the names of the lakes are:

  • Lake Superior
  • Lake Michigan
  • Lake Huron
  • Lake Erie
  • Lake Ontario

84% of fresh water in North America comes from these lakes. This comprises about 20% of the surface fresh water in the world. Besides drinking, they are used also used for power generation, recreation, transportation, etc.

<h3>What is Audience analysis?</h3>
  • In the early phases of a project, technical writers frequently carry out the duty of audience analysis.
  • It entails evaluating the audience to ensure that the information being delivered to them is at the proper level.
  • All communications must be directed towards the identified audience, which is sometimes referred to as the end-user.
  • When defining an audience, numerous aspects must be taken into account, including age, culture, and topic understanding.
  • A profile of the intended audience may be constructed after taking into account all the known criteria, enabling authors to provide content that the audience will understand.
